Form in Motion: A Sculptor's Treatise on Materiality and Meaning delves into the profound dialogue between material, form, and meaning in the world of sculpture.

This book is not just a technical manual; it's an exploration of the very essence of sculptural creation, a journey into the heart of artistic expression. It begins by laying a philosophical foundation, exploring the intertwined relationship between the artist's initial idea and the final, tangible form. It posits that materials are not mere mediums but active participants in the creative process, possessing a language of their own that speaks to both artist and observer.

The book then embarks on a sensory exploration of the intrinsic qualities of various sculptural materials. Discover the silent strength of stone, its inherent permanence and the way it yields to the sculptor's touch. Feel the organic whisper of wood, its warmth and responsiveness, the stories etched in its grain. Experience the cold embrace of metal, its sleekness and strength, its capacity to reflect light and capture form. Understanding these inherent qualities is key to unlocking the expressive potential of each material.

From the foundational role of the artist's hand to the intricate dance of tools and material, the book unveils the practical aspects of sculptural practice. It guides you through the processes of carving and shaping, casting and molding, joining and assembling, and the crucial finishing touches that bring a vision to life. Each technique is explored with clarity and depth, providing insights into the transformative power of the sculptor's skill.

The interplay of positive and negative space takes center stage, revealing how the void surrounding a sculpture contributes as much to its impact as the form itself. The book delves into the creation of the illusion of depth, exploring how sculptors manipulate light and shadow to enhance the viewer's perception and create a sense of three-dimensionality.

Motion Implied explores the captivating challenge of capturing movement in a static medium. Discover how the stillness of gesture, the flow of line, and the interplay of balance and tension can imbue a sculpture with dynamism and energy. The book also examines the use of rhythm and repetition to create a sense of implied motion, suggesting a narrative frozen in time.

Beyond the physical, the book delves into the realm of meaning. It analyzes the symbolism inherent in sculptural forms and the influence of cultural contexts on both the creation and interpretation of art. By connecting the physical properties of materials to their cultural and historical significance, the book enriches the understanding of a sculpture's impact and its enduring power to communicate across time and cultures.

Finally, the book reflects on the future of form in sculpture, considering the impact of evolving technologies and emerging artistic trends. It contemplates the lasting legacy of sculpture and its enduring ability to leave an indelible impression on individuals and societies. This book is an essential resource for aspiring and established sculptors, art enthusiasts, and anyone seeking to deepen their understanding of the transformative power of art.
